: timer event as well. Problem is that my screens don't seem to update
: when using GrGetNextEventTimeout. Everything else looks right in the
: code. I'm basically using a couple of offscreen windows, and when one
: taps/clicks on a tab-like-thingy to change the 'mode', I switch the
: exposed window with GrCopyArea.
I assume that everything except for the clock works perfectly
when not using the GetNextEventTimeout. If not, my response
won't apply.
There is a small possibility that your application is falling prey to
the bug that we just fixed in 0.89pre7 (to be released hopefully tonight).
In this case, if you return from a GetNextTimeout w/o timeing out,
and then you execute another GrXXX call, you may lose events,
and it sounds like you're losing the expose event. Try commenting
out any draw/server calls during timeout processing. If that fixes
the problem, then my client.c fix should fix this problem as well.
